A Step-by-Step Guide to the Top Car Tech of 2026

  1. The Safety Layer: Mastering ADAS

    This is your foundation. In 2026, nearly every new car came with some level of ADAS, but the capability varied wildly. The key is understanding "SAE Levels of Driving Automation." Most new cars in 2026 operate at Level 2. This means the car can control steering and acceleration/braking simultaneously, but you must remain fully engaged. Think of Adaptive Cruise Control with Lane Centering. "Hands-Free" systems like Ford's BlueCruise or GM's Super Cruise are considered Level 2+, as they function on pre-mapped highways, but you are still responsible. The real leap, which we saw emerge in limited-production vehicles, is Level 3, where the car is in control under specific conditions, and you can truly be "eyes off" the road. For most 2026 cars, focus on how smoothly and intuitively the Level 2 systems work during your test drive.

  2. The Command Center: Decoding Infotainment & Connectivity

    This is where you'll interact with the car every single day. The big story in 2026 was the battle of the operating systems. You had cars with Android Automotive OS (like in Polestar, Volvo, and some GM vehicles), which is a full OS with the Google Play Store built-in, and cars that simply offered screen projection via Apple CarPlay and Android Auto. The former offers deeper integration, but the latter provides a more familiar phone-based interface. A critical, non-negotiable feature that became standard in 2026 is Over-the-Air (OTA) updates. Just like your smartphone, this allows the manufacturer to send software updates to fix bugs, add features, and even improve performance remotely. A car without OTA is like a phone that never gets an update—it's already obsolete.

  3. The Power Plant: Understanding Powertrain Evolution

    For Electric Vehicles (EVs), the conversation in 2026 shifted from just range to charging speed and efficiency. The key technology here is 800-volt architecture. Cars built on this platform (like the Hyundai Ioniq 5/6, Porsche Taycan) can accept much faster DC charging speeds, potentially adding over 100 miles of range in under 10 minutes at a compatible 350kW charger. This dramatically reduces road trip anxiety. For Plug-in Hybrids (PHEVs), we saw all-electric ranges regularly pushing past the 40-mile mark, making daily commutes entirely gas-free for many users. It represented a mature, practical middle ground for those not ready to go fully electric.

  4. The Smart Co-Pilot: Recognizing AI's Influence

    AI was the secret ingredient sprinkled throughout 2026's top vehicles, often working invisibly. It's the magic behind vastly improved voice assistants that understand natural language ("I'm cold" instead of "Set temperature to 72 degrees"). It's in the navigation systems that use real-time traffic data and your driving habits to predict arrival times more accurately. Some advanced systems even use AI for predictive maintenance, alerting you to a potential issue before it becomes a problem. While not a single button you can press, the sophistication of a car's AI is what separates a good tech experience from a truly great, intuitive one.

Silas's Pro Tips for Navigating Car Tech

  • The 'Tech' Test Drive: When you test drive a car, spend at least 10 minutes in the parking lot just playing with the infotainment system. Connect your phone. Try the voice commands. Adjust the settings. If it's frustrating while you're stationary, it will be infuriating while you're driving.
  • My Biggest Mistake Was Chasing the 'Newest' Thing: I once bought a car in its first model year with a brand-new, unproven infotainment OS. It was a buggy nightmare for six months until the OTA updates finally fixed the worst of it. The lesson? Sometimes the most reliable tech is a system that's been on the market for a year and has had its kinks worked out.
  • Ask About the Data Plan: Many connected features, like advanced navigation or Wi-Fi hotspots, require a subscription after an initial trial period. Always ask the salesperson what features will be disabled if you don't pay for the data plan down the road.
  • Future-Proofing Your Choice: The single most important feature for a car's long-term value and usability is OTA updates. Second to that, for EVs, is the fastest possible charging speed. These two features ensure your car will get better, or at least not feel dated, over time.

Frequently Asked Questions

What is the main difference between Level 2 and Level 3 autonomy?

In Level 2, the car assists you, but you are 100% responsible for driving at all times. In Level 3, the car is in full control under specific, limited conditions, and the manufacturer assumes liability during that time.

Is a car with Android Automotive OS better than one with just CarPlay?

It's a matter of preference. Android Automotive offers deeper vehicle integration and native apps without your phone, while Apple CarPlay provides a familiar, user-friendly interface that many people already know and love.

Are Over-the-Air (OTA) updates really that important?

Absolutely. OTA updates are crucial for security patches, bug fixes, and adding new features, ensuring your car's technology remains current and functional long after you've purchased it.

What is V2X technology and why should I care?

V2X stands for "Vehicle-to-Everything." It allows your car to communicate with other cars (V2V), infrastructure like traffic lights (V2I), and pedestrians (V2P). In 2026 it was an emerging tech that will be foundational for future safety and traffic efficiency improvements.
